187 static void
188 cook_cat(FILE *fp)
189 {
190 	int ch, gobble, line, prev;
191 
192 	/* Reset EOF condition on stdin. */
193 	if (fp == stdin && feof(stdin))
194 		clearerr(stdin);
195 
196 	line = gobble = 0;
197 	for (prev = '\n'; (ch = getc(fp)) != EOF; prev = ch) {
198 		if (prev == '\n') {
199 			if (sflag) {
200 				if (ch == '\n') {
201 					if (gobble)
202 						continue;
203 					gobble = 1;
204 				} else
205 					gobble = 0;
206 			}
207 			if (nflag && (!bflag || ch != '\n')) {
208 				(void)fprintf(stdout, "%6d\t", ++line);
209 				if (ferror(stdout))
210 					break;
211 			}
212 		}
213 		if (ch == '\n') {
214 			if (eflag && putchar('$') == EOF)
215 				break;
216 		} else if (ch == '\t') {
217 			if (tflag) {
218 				if (putchar('^') == EOF || putchar('I') == EOF)
219 					break;
220 				continue;
221 			}
222 		} else if (vflag) {
223 			if (!isascii(ch) && !isprint(ch)) {
224 				if (putchar('M') == EOF || putchar('-') == EOF)
225 					break;
226 				ch = toascii(ch);
227 			}
228 			if (iscntrl(ch)) {
229 				if (putchar('^') == EOF ||
230 				    putchar(ch == '\177' ? '?' :
231 				    ch | 0100) == EOF)
232 					break;
233 				continue;
234 			}
235 		}
236 		if (putchar(ch) == EOF)
237 			break;
238 	}
239 	if (ferror(fp)) {
240 		warn("%s", filename);
241 		rval = 1;
242 		clearerr(fp);
243 	}
244 	if (ferror(stdout))
245 		err(1, "stdout");
246 }

248 static void
249 raw_cat(int rfd)
250 {
251 	int off, wfd;
252 	ssize_t nr, nw;
253 	static size_t bsize;
254 	static char *buf = NULL;
255 	struct stat sbuf;
256 
257 	wfd = fileno(stdout);
258 	if (buf == NULL) {
259 		if (fstat(wfd, &sbuf))
260 			err(1, "%s", filename);
261 		if (S_ISREG(sbuf.st_mode)) {
262 			/* If there's plenty of RAM, use a large copy buffer */
263 			if (sysconf(_SC_PHYS_PAGES) > PHYSPAGES_THRESHOLD)
264 				bsize = MIN(BUFSIZE_MAX, MAXPHYS*8);
265 			else
266 				bsize = BUFSIZE_SMALL;
267 		} else
268 			bsize = MAX(sbuf.st_blksize,
269 					(blksize_t)sysconf(_SC_PAGESIZE));
270 		if ((buf = malloc(bsize)) == NULL)
271 			err(1, "malloc() failure of IO buffer");
272 	}
273 	while ((nr = read(rfd, buf, bsize)) > 0)
274 		for (off = 0; nr; nr -= nw, off += nw)
275 			if ((nw = write(wfd, buf + off, (size_t)nr)) < 0)
276 				err(1, "stdout");
277 	if (nr < 0) {
278 		warn("%s", filename);
279 		rval = 1;
280 	}
281 }
